Common Automotive Locksmith Problems We See in Kirby
- Misdiagnosed transponder failures. A dead fob battery gets blamed when the real culprit is a worn transponder chip from climate stress across multiple PCS moves. We test the chip before selling you a battery you do not need.
- Ignition cylinder wear from high-mileage Randolph commutes. The repeated start-stop cycles on the short but frequent drive to base grind tumblers down. We catch this early and repair before extraction becomes necessary.
- Aftermarket key incompatibility on older vehicles. Pre-2000s trucks and sedans in Kirby’s original neighborhoods often need non-standard blanks or modified head shapes. We verify fit before cutting, not after.
- Lockouts misrouted to SAPD instead of Kirby PD. San Antonio-based dispatchers sometimes miss Kirby’s separate jurisdiction, delaying police-assisted openings near base property. We call Kirby PD direct.
Pricing for Automotive Locksmith in Kirby, TX
Here’s what automotive locksmith work costs in the Kirby market:
- Car lockout (standard): $65-$95
- Car lockout (complex/high-security): $95-$140
- Basic key duplication: $45-$85
- Transponder key cut + programmed: $145-$265
- Key fob programming only: $85-$175
- Key fob replacement + programming: $125-$245
- Ignition repair: $120-$220
- Ignition replacement: $240-$380
- Emergency/after-hours surcharge: +$25-$45
These are the ranges we quote flat on the phone. The price we quote is the price you pay. Factors that move you within a range: vehicle year and make, key complexity, time of day, and whether programming requires dealer-level equipment.
